1. Environmentally Friendly

Ethanol fireplaces are an eco-friendly alternative to traditional chimney fireplaces and wood-burning stoves. They offer the same ambience as well as the fire-look and smell as traditional fireplaces, but without the ash, soot and odor. They can be utilized in almost any room of your home or office.

If you decide to install an ethanol fire to your space it's essential to follow all safety guidelines that come with it. These guidelines will be laid out in the owner's manual, which is typically included with each model of bioethanol fireplace. Some examples include avoiding adding more fuel to a fireplace that is burning bioethanol fire and always allowing it to cool down completely before refilling. Also, ensure that your bioethanol white fireplace is kept away from any combustible material and is never moved while it's burning.

The use of fireplaces that run on ethanol are more secure than fireplaces that use gas. They do not emit carbon monoxide, which can cause serious health problems. However, as with any open flame, it is important to keep these fireplaces clear from combustible materials and children. It is also important to have a fire extinguisher in your home in case of an emergency.

Because they don't create smoke, soot, or odor The ethanol fireplaces are less troublesome to maintain than traditional chimney fireplaces. In addition, they do not require elaborate ventilation systems or chimneys built-in to circulate air. This makes them an attractive and convenient choice for homeowners who wish to experience the appearance of real fires but without the hassle.

Although ethanol fireplaces provide warmth, they aren't the same level of warmth as a wood-burning fireplace or gas stove. Therefore, they may not be an ideal choice for those looking to make a major heating upgrade.

While fireplaces made of ethanol can be set up and operated safely, they must also be used correctly to avoid fire or damage dangers. Installation instructions should be followed and avoid placing them near flammable materials, like curtains or clothing. It's recommended to keep them at a minimum of one metre from pets and children, and to use caution when lighting them.

2. No Smoke or Ash

Ethanol fireplaces are clean burning, making them a great choice for those concerned about the environmental dangers. They do not produce smoke or water, and have no chimneys or pipes. This makes them an excellent alternative to traditional fireplaces, which produce a lot of smoke and ash, which must be removed from the chimney as well as other areas of the home.

The majority of ethanol burners have a simple control panel can be used to alter the flame's brightness and size and also to switch the unit on or out. You can also use the lid to extinguish the fire by pushing it across the opening. Since the fire is burning in the burner, it is important to be cautious. Keep it away from clothing or fabrics that could catch fire.

Except for a small amount of soot which may be deposited on the burner or other surfaces, ethanol fire places are virtually smoke-free. This makes them a fantastic alternative for homes with pets or children. They can also be employed in bars, restaurants commercial spaces, and restaurants.

You can install ethanol fireplaces in any room, even those with no chimneys, since they don't require vents. They can be used outside, which is why hotels and spas adore them. The majority of them are freestanding and don't require installation. However, some can be installed into the wall or framed to create a "firebox".

Because they don't need a flue or chimney, installing an ethanol fireplace is cheaper than other kinds of outdoor or indoor fire features. Some models are mobile and can be moved easily which is a significant benefit if you plan to sell your home in the future or just moving to a new location.

Like any other fire feature, ethanol fireplaces should never be installed in homes that are tightly sealed or small indoor spaces and they should be placed near a carbon monoxide detector. They should also be used with the fuel made of ethanol that is specifically made specifically for this fireplace. Utilizing a different type of fuel could lead to explosions or fires.

3. Easy to Maintain

Ethanol marble fireplaces are easier to maintain than traditional fire places. They don't generate soot or ash, and they can be used outdoors or indoors. They don't require a chimney flue making them a great option for apartments. They're usually a simple installation task that can be accomplished by anyone who knows how to use a drill.

The most important thing you should do is ensure that your ethanol fire stays filled with fuel and clean it regularly. Make sure to keep flammable materials away from the fire and only use the amount of fuel recommended by the manufacturer. Insufficient fuel could cause the flame to become too large, and may cause combustible items to catch fire. Set the fireplace in a place that it is not hit by objects that move or run into while it is on.

Most ethanol fireplaces don't produce much heat, so they should not be used as the primary source of heat. The exception to this is models that can be adjusted to a heat setting. The higher the setting, the more heat it produces.

When you are choosing an ethanol-fire, it's important to look for one that's certified by a credible organization. This could be an indication that the company cares about safety. Look for features that will aid in maintaining the safety of your fireplace, such as a lid that regulates flame size or an empty tray.

Ethanol fireplaces are available in different styles and sizes. They can be installed like a flat-screen TV or placed in a wall. If you decide to hang your ethanol fire, they usually come with mounting hardware so you can simply put it onto the wall and then plug it in. If you decide to recess your bio fire into the wall, you'll need to have a professional do it for you. You can buy prefabricated wall mounted ethanol fireplaces ranging from $300 to $5,600. Or you can employ someone to do the work for you. It should take about an hour to set up the wall-mounted bio fireplace.
